The 2013 Harley-Davidson® CVO™ Ultra Classic® Electra Glide® model is a high-end performance motorcycle with Twin Cam 110™ power that gives you the ultimate in premium featured touring. For 2013, the CVO™ Ultra Classic® Electra Glide® model comes in an even more limited availability, serialized 110th Anniversary Special Edition, featuring exclusive commemorative anniversary styling elements, premium features and finely forged finishes that make it a top-of-the-line model and a true work of motorcycle art. This bike is powered by a Harley® Twin Cam 110™ Engine. This Twin Cam engine with Screamin’ Eagle badges provides 110 cubic inches of power, a low cruising rpm, and lots of low end torque. Setting this bike's CVO™ Twin Cam 110™ engine apart from the rest is the granite powertrain. This big V-Twin Cam 110™ performance motorcycle is custom touring at its finest. Harley-Davidson Recalls 250,000 Motorcycles for Rear Brake Light Switches

Mon, 24 Oct 2011

Harley-Davidson is issuing a recall for 250,757 units from its Touring, CVO Touring and Trike line from model years 2009 – 2012. The rear brake light switch on the models in question may become degraded due to the heat from the exhaust systems. This may affect brake light function and may result in a brake fluid leak.

Afghan Heroes tribute Harley MT350

Tue, 29 Nov 2011

The above Harley-Davidson MT350 has been created in honor of the UK soldiers killed over the last ten years in the Afghanistan conflict. This particular MT350 was previously used by British forces in Afghanistan and will now act as a memorial for the charity Afghan Heroes. The tribute was created by Paul Ferguson and Martin Turner, and now features the name of each fallen serviceman or woman, accompanied by their age and the date they were killed in action.
